eCommerce North Innovator Challenge

Six-week program helping Canadian D2C founders scale sales and compete for $1,500 grants.

Organizer: Elevate
Deadline: September 21, 2026 (in 22 days)
Category: Competition/Challenge
Country: Canada

The eCommerce North Innovator Challenge is a free six-week program designed for early-stage, direct-to-consumer (D2C) e-commerce ventures looking to increase sales and scale their businesses. Participants take part in an intensive program focused on strengthening their business pitch, growing their email list, and optimizing their website for improved sales conversions. The program helps founders better capture consumer demand, unlock new sales opportunities, and prepare their businesses for the next stage of growth.


Program Highlights

• Mentorship and Skill Building: Receive mentorship and coaching from experienced professionals at Moneris and Elevate. Through practical sessions and hands-on learning, participants will develop skills in areas such as social media marketing, email marketing, sales, SEO, and website optimization.

• Valuable Connections: Access the eCommerce North alumni network, build relationships with fellow entrepreneurs, connect with industry experts, and gain opportunities for introductions to relevant partners and collaborators.

• Virtual Pitch Competition: Present your venture to a panel of judges during the final pitch competition and compete for one of three CAD $1,500 grants to support your business’s continued growth and development.

Eligibility Criteria

• Business Age: Open to e-commerce ventures that are 0–5 years old.

• Founder Profile: Founders should demonstrate strong entrepreneurial commitment, whether they are building their business alongside a full-time job or working on it full-time.

• Industry Sectors: Open to D2C businesses across a range of consumer sectors, including beauty, wellness, apparel, home goods, food, and other consumer products.

• Online Presence: Applicants must have an active and engaging social media presence.

Key Dates

• Application Open: August 14, 2026

• Application Close: September 21, 2026

• Program Kick Off: October 26, 2026

• Program Ends: December 3, 2026
